Abstract
To realize imaging X-ray spectroscopy with high-energy resolution, we proposed a new pixellated array of Ir-TES. In this type of device, the bias point of each pixel is slightly modified. Therefore the analysis of the pulse shape parameter, such as the pulse height, the rise time and the fall time of a signal pulse, can identify the incident pixel position. We have obtained 13 eV (FWHM) at 3 keV energy resolution and 80 μm position resolution for 10 pixel devices. At this moment we could successfully operate a 20 pixel device.
